魔方吧·中文魔方俱乐部

标题: 问5个问题,猜生日 [打印本页]

作者: Osullivan    时间: 2009-7-7 13:25:08     标题: 问5个问题,猜生日

刚看了superacid的“求概率(大家讨论讨论)”题目,突然想到这个题,貌似简单多了,但拿出来讨论讨论:允许问对方5个问题,对方只回答是或否,怎么猜出对方生日?
作者: 专业新手    时间: 2009-7-7 13:27:43

先占楼
再想~~~~~~~~~~~~~~`
别再骂我了
年份也要猜????????
我只能问出第几个月的第几个星期。。。。。。。。。。。。。。。

[ 本帖最后由 专业新手 于 2009-7-7 13:41 编辑 ]
作者: Osullivan    时间: 2009-7-7 13:35:27

原帖由 专业新手 于 2009-7-7 13:27 发表
先占楼
再想~~~~~~~~~~~~~~`
别再骂我了
年份也要猜????????



既然问这个问题?
你认为可能知道年份吗?
PS:月份可能知道吗?
你解决了告诉我声~~~~~~
作者: JAVE    时间: 2009-7-7 13:37:30

额。 我猜猜我知道了  1965年 7 月4日。。。
作者: haohmaru    时间: 2009-7-7 13:53:03

一年又365天
要想5个问题问出生日
必须每个问题能排除2/3的日期才行

可只能回答“是”或“否”
保险的话一次最多排除1/2的日期
否则就存在一定几率5个问题之内猜不到

按照每个问题能排除2/3的日期来计算,
5个问题猜出生日的几率就是:
(2/3)^5
约为8.78%
作者: 357433865    时间: 2009-7-7 14:26:53

5个问题是吧?如果我的问题是同一句话,那么算同一个问题还是不同的问题呢?
如:列出365天,按顺序问他,“你的生日是这天吗?”回答否,“这天吗?”否,“这天吗?”否…………哈哈,总有一个回答是的,搞掂!
作者: haohmaru    时间: 2009-7-7 21:37:10

原帖由 357433865 于 2009-7-7 14:26 发表
5个问题是吧?如果我的问题是同一句话,那么算同一个问题还是不同的问题呢?
如:列出365天,按顺序问他,“你的生日是这天吗?”回答否,“这天吗?”否,“这天吗?”否…………哈哈,总有一个回答是的,搞掂!

5个问题的意思是你只能问5次
作者: shadowyang    时间: 2009-7-8 11:29:49

假设5个问题都能够设计成是否的可能1:1的话,5个问题能够确定到32分之1,然后在11个里面猜一个了,和5楼的概率差不多,但不是一回事。
但是还是不能准确猜出生日。看来问题关键在于问题要怎么问,能够通过问题的组合多排除一些。
放在这里,我先想想。
作者: flwb    时间: 2009-7-8 11:46:47

原帖由 Osullivan 于 2009-7-7 13:35 发表



既然问这个问题?
你认为可能知道年份吗?
PS:月份可能知道吗?
你解决了告诉我声~~~~~~

听你这么说,你的问题只是猜几号生日,不用管年月,是吗?
作者: migl    时间: 2009-7-8 14:40:21

这个问题不能定得太死吧。

能否酌情改为“猜出生日,你至少要提问几次?”
作者: yzsjw0    时间: 2009-7-9 18:58:53

问对方5个问题:对方只回答一个字,可猜出日;对方只回答两个字,可猜出月日;对方只回答三个字,可猜出年月日(如果对方年龄不超过32岁的话)。
作者: shadowyang    时间: 2009-7-9 23:27:39

原帖由 Osullivan 于 2009-7-7 13:35 发表



既然问这个问题?
你认为可能知道年份吗?
PS:月份可能知道吗?
你解决了告诉我声~~~~~~


月份应该也不能知道吧,每次只能去掉一半可能最后32分之1
作者: migl    时间: 2009-7-10 15:31:56

用不用考虑365与366的区别?
作者: flwb    时间: 2009-7-19 21:08:43

最少4次,最多5次.
作者: NicholasKan    时间: 2009-7-19 21:15:53

要用到黄金分割吧?
作者: nick159951    时间: 2009-7-19 21:18:31

用5个问题可以问出日,好像可以根据二进制制成的5个条子····




欢迎光临 魔方吧·中文魔方俱乐部 (http://bbs.mf8-china.com/) Powered by Discuz! X2